Output e126ae9f0c21c8dba6d33121755947c949e38df2b748cd2068223f98840f09d7:40

value
4594000
script pubkey
OP_0 OP_PUSHBYTES_20 bffda420b743ab4a82853412169e02e43929234b
address
bc1qhl76gg9hgw454q59xsfpd8szusujjg6t55sf5a
transaction
e126ae9f0c21c8dba6d33121755947c949e38df2b748cd2068223f98840f09d7
spent
true